China hopes North Korean visit will 'develop' ties

Description

A Chinese delegation will visit North Korea will demonstrate "the deep friendship" between the two countries, says Mao Ning, a Chinese Foreign Ministry spokesperson. The delegation, described as "high level" will visit North Korea this week and attend celebrations for the 75th anniversary of the country's foundation.
